Green Glow (arcane, aura, poison, radiation)

15 feet. A creature beginning its turn in the aura must attempt a DC 37 fortitude save to avoid becoming Sickened 1 (or Sickened 2 on a critical failure). A creature that's already sickened instead becomes Enfeebled 1 on a failure (or Enfeebled 2 on a critical failure) for 24 hours.

Security Alert Reaction

Trigger The abysium sentinel becomes aware of an unfamiliar creature


Effect The abysium sentinel alerts its owner of an intruder, either with a mental or audible alarm, depending on established orders. The mental alarm has a range of 1 mile.

Statue's Head One Action (concentrate)

Until the next time it acts, the abysium sentinel appears to be the head of a statue it's perched atop. It has an automatic result of 58 on Deception checks and DCs to pass as nothing more than a statue's head.


This creature is crafted from a toxic skymetal known as abysium.


Thassilonian sentinels are crafted in the shapes of skulls or heads.

Sentinel Sets

Thassilonian sentinels were typically carved from marble, ivory, and bronze, easily blending in with most statues. Rarer sentinels carved from wood, coral, and skymetals were often commissioned in sets alongside matching statues to ensure seamless fits or were carefully sculpted for display alone.

Construct

A construct is an artificial creature empowered by a force other than vitality or void. Constructs are often mindless; they are immune to bleed, death effects, disease, healing, nonlethal attacks, poison, spirit, vitality, void, and the doomed, drained, fatigued, paralyzed, sickened, and unconscious conditions; and they may have Hardness based on the materials used to construct their bodies. Constructs are not living creatures, nor are they undead. When reduced to 0 Hit Points, a construct creature is destroyed.
